Step 1
In a mixing bowl beat egg and sugar until thick.
Step 2
In a separate bowl combine flour, baking powder and salt.
Step 3
Alternately add flour and milk to egg mixture. Beat after each addition until blended.
Step 4
Stir in melted butter.
Step 5
Fold in blueberries.
Step 6
Pour batter into a greased and floured 8 inch square baking pan. Sprinkle with 2 tablespoons of sugar.
Step 7
Cover and refrigerate overnight.
Step 8
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Bake for 35 minutes or until top springs back when lightly touched. Brush top with remaining butter.Cool before cutting.
Step 9
*** NOTE *** When making muffins with this recipe I bake them about 18-20 minutes. Check oven to be sure that they spring back before removing.
